La guía para principiantes sobre Arquitectura Empresarial: Una visión definitiva

En el entorno digital moderno, las organizaciones enfrentan una red compleja de tecnologías, procesos empresariales y flujos de datos. Sin un plan coherente, estos elementos suelen operar en silos, lo que conduce a ineficiencias, redundancias y desalineación estratégica. Es aquí donde entra en escena la Arquitectura Empresarial (EA). Sirve como puente que conecta la estrategia empresarial con la ejecución de TI.

Esta guía ofrece una visión completa de lo que implica la Arquitectura Empresarial, los dominios centrales que abarca y cómo funciona como un activo estratégico para organizaciones de cualquier tamaño. Ya sea que usted sea un interesado, un desarrollador o un analista de negocios, comprender la EA es crucial para navegar transformaciones complejas.

Hand-drawn whiteboard infographic illustrating Enterprise Architecture fundamentals: central bridge connecting business strategy to IT execution, four color-coded core domains (Business Architecture in blue for strategy and processes, Data Architecture in green for governance and flow, Application Architecture in orange for systems and APIs, Technology Architecture in purple for infrastructure and security), key frameworks including TOGAF cyclical method, Zachman matrix, and ArchiMate modeling language, five-phase implementation roadmap from initiation to monitoring, core benefits checklist (strategic alignment, standardization, agility, cost optimization), and emerging trends icons for cloud-native, AI-driven data, Agile integration, and automation—all rendered in sketchy marker style on whiteboard texture background for approachable visual learning

¿Qué es la Arquitectura Empresarial? 🧭

La Arquitectura Empresarial no se limita simplemente a dibujar diagramas o seleccionar herramientas de software. Es una disciplina que alinea la estrategia empresarial de una organización con sus necesidades de tecnología de la información. Proporciona una visión integral de la empresa, asegurando que cada inversión digital apoye un resultado empresarial específico.

  • Alineación Estratégica:Garantiza que los proyectos de TI apoyen directamente los objetivos empresariales.
  • Estandarización:Reduce la complejidad estableciendo estándares comunes en toda la organización.
  • Agilidad:Permite una adaptación más rápida a los cambios del mercado al tener una comprensión clara de las capacidades actuales.
  • Optimización de costos:Identifica redundancias en sistemas y procesos para reducir el desperdicio.

Piense en la EA como el plano de un edificio. Al igual que un arquitecto asegura que la fundación, la instalación eléctrica y la plomería funcionen juntas antes de colocar la primera piedra, la EA garantiza que las unidades empresariales, los datos, las aplicaciones y la infraestructura funcionen de manera coherente.

Los cuatro dominios centrales de la EA 🏗️

La Arquitectura Empresarial generalmente se divide en cuatro dominios principales. Estos dominios representan las diferentes capas de la organización que requieren mapeo y alineación.

Cada dominio interactúa con los demás, creando un ecosistema complejo pero interconectado.

  • Arquitectura Empresarial:Describe la estrategia empresarial, la gobernanza, la organización y los procesos empresariales clave.
  • Arquitectura de Datos:Define cómo se almacenan, gestionan y utilizan los datos en toda la empresa.
  • Arquitectura de Aplicaciones:Define el plano para aplicaciones individuales y sus interacciones.
  • Arquitectura de Tecnología:Describe la infraestructura de hardware, software y redes necesaria para soportar las aplicaciones.
Dominio Área de enfoque Preguntas clave
Empresarial Estrategia y Operaciones ¿Cómo creamos valor? ¿Cuáles son nuestros procesos?
Datos Información y Conocimiento ¿Dónde viven los datos? ¿Quién los posee? ¿Cómo se protegen?
Aplicación Servicios de Software ¿Qué sistemas respaldan nuestros procesos? ¿Cómo se comunican entre sí?
Tecnología Infraestructura ¿Qué servidores, redes y nubes se requieren?

1. Arquitectura Empresarial 🏢

Este dominio se enfoca en el lado empresarial de la ecuación. Incluye declaraciones de misión, estructuras organizacionales y capacidades empresariales. Define las capacidades que la organización necesita para cumplir su propuesta de valor. Por ejemplo, si una empresa desea ofrecer soporte al cliente en tiempo real, la Arquitectura Empresarial define la capacidad de “Soporte en Tiempo Real” y los procesos necesarios para habilitarla.

  • Unidades Organizacionales
  • Funciones Empresariales
  • Flujos de Procesos
  • Roles y Responsabilidades

2. Arquitectura de Datos 🗄️

Los datos a menudo se consideran el activo más valioso de una empresa. La Arquitectura de Datos garantiza que los datos sean accesibles, confiables y seguros. Define los modelos de datos, el flujo de datos y las políticas de gobernanza de datos. En una era de análisis y inteligencia artificial, los datos limpios y estructurados son fundamentales.

  • Modelos de Datos Lógicos y Físicos
  • Estándares de Datos y Metadatos
  • Seguridad y Privacidad de Datos
  • Patrones de Integración de Datos

3. Arquitectura de Aplicaciones 📱

Este dominio representa las aplicaciones de software individuales que respaldan los procesos empresariales. Examina el portafolio de aplicaciones, su ciclo de vida y sus relaciones. El objetivo es evitar la “arquitectura espagueti”, donde demasiados sistemas se comunican entre sí de formas complejas e inmanejables.

  • Portafolios de Aplicaciones
  • Interfaces de Sistema y APIs
  • Arquitectura Orientada a Servicios (SOA)
  • Nube frente al Alojamiento de Aplicaciones en Instalaciones Propias

4. Arquitectura de Tecnología 🖥️

La capa fundamental. Este dominio cubre la infraestructura física y virtual necesaria para ejecutar las aplicaciones y almacenar los datos. Incluye hardware de servidores, equipos de red, entornos en la nube e infraestructura de seguridad.

  • Topología de red
  • Infraestructura de servidores y almacenamiento
  • Servicios y proveedores en la nube
  • Protocolos y estándares de seguridad

Frameworks comunes de arquitectura empresarial 📐

Los frameworks proporcionan un enfoque estructurado para desarrollar y utilizar una arquitectura. Ofrecen vocabulario, mejores prácticas y plantillas para guiar el proceso. Aunque las organizaciones a menudo adaptan estos frameworks a sus necesidades específicas, proporcionan un punto de partida sólido.

Framework Enfoque principal Ideal para
TOGAF Propósito general Grandes empresas, gobierno, industrias diversas
Zachman Esquema descriptivo Inventario y clasificación exhaustivos
FEAF Gobierno Agencias del sector público
ArchiMate Lenguaje de modelado Visualización y documentación de arquitecturas

TOGAF (Marco de arquitectura del Grupo Abierto)

TOGAF es uno de los frameworks más ampliamente utilizados a nivel mundial. Se centra en el Método de Desarrollo de Arquitectura (ADM), un enfoque paso a paso para desarrollar una arquitectura. Es iterativo y cíclico, lo que permite una mejora continua. El núcleo de TOGAF es el Marco de Contenido de Arquitectura, que define qué artefactos se producen.

Marco de Zachman

El marco de Zachman no es un proceso, sino una ontología. Es un esquema para organizar los artefactos arquitectónicos. Está estructurado como una matriz con seis perspectivas (Qué, Cómo, Dónde, Quién, Cuándo, Por qué) y seis niveles de abstracción (Planificador, Propietario, Diseñador, Constructor, Subcontratista, Usuario). Garantiza que cada aspecto de la arquitectura se documente desde cada punto de vista necesario.

ArchiMate

ArchiMate es un lenguaje de modelado que proporciona una forma uniforme de describir, analizar y visualizar arquitecturas empresariales y de TI. Permite a los arquitectos crear diagramas claros que muestran las relaciones entre las capas de negocio, aplicaciones y tecnología. A menudo se utiliza junto con TOGAF.

Partes interesadas clave y gobernanza 🤝

La arquitectura empresarial es un esfuerzo colaborativo. El éxito depende de involucrar a las personas adecuadas y establecer mecanismos de gobernanza claros. Sin el apoyo ejecutivo, las iniciativas de arquitectura empresarial a menudo se estancan.

  • Director de Información (CIO): Normalmente patrocina la función de Arquitectura Empresarial y asegura que la TI se alinee con la estrategia empresarial.
  • Arquitectos Empresariales: Los profesionales que diseñan y documentan la arquitectura.
  • Líderes Empresariales: Proporcionan la dirección estratégica y los requisitos.
  • Desarrolladores e Ingenieros: Implementan la arquitectura y proporcionan retroalimentación sobre su viabilidad.
  • Oficiales de Seguridad: Aseguran que se cumplan los estándares de cumplimiento y seguridad.

Establecimiento de Gobernanza

La gobernanza asegura que la arquitectura realmente se siga. Implica órganos de toma de decisiones que revisan proyectos para garantizar que se adhieran a los estándares definidos.

  • Comités de Revisión de Arquitectura (ARB): Grupos que revisan nuevos proyectos según los estándares de arquitectura.
  • Normas: Reglas claras sobre elecciones de tecnología, estándares de codificación y formatos de datos.
  • Cumplimiento: Monitoreo para asegurar el cumplimiento de políticas y regulaciones.

Implementación de la Arquitectura Empresarial 🚀

Empezar un programa de Arquitectura Empresarial puede parecer abrumador. Requiere un enfoque por fases para asegurar que el valor se entregue rápidamente mientras se construyen capacidades a largo plazo. Aquí hay una ruta típica para la implementación.

Fase 1: Iniciación y Alcance

Defina el alcance de la arquitectura. ¿Es para toda la empresa o para una división específica? Identifique a los principales interesados y asegure su compromiso. Defina los objetivos, como la reducción de costos o una mayor agilidad.

Fase 2: Evaluación de Estado Base

Comprenda el estado actual. Documente los procesos, sistemas y flujos de datos existentes. Identifique las brechas entre el estado actual y el estado futuro deseado. Esto suele implicar encuestas, entrevistas y talleres de descubrimiento.

Fase 3: Diseño de la Arquitectura Objetivo

Diseñe el estado futuro. Esto implica definir las arquitecturas ideal de negocio, datos, aplicaciones y tecnología. Debe reflejar las metas estratégicas identificadas en la Fase 1.

Fase 4: Planificación de la Migración

Cree una hoja de ruta para pasar del estado base al objetivo. Esto incluye priorizar proyectos, estimar costos y programar plazos. Es crucial identificar éxitos rápidos que demuestren valor desde el principio.

Fase 5: Implementación y Monitoreo

Ejecute el plan de migración. Monitoree el progreso frente a la hoja de ruta. Actualice la arquitectura a medida que cambie el entorno. La EA no es un proyecto único; es un ciclo continuo.

Desafíos Comunes y Trampas ⚠️

Aunque se cuente con un plan sólido, las iniciativas de Arquitectura Empresarial enfrentan obstáculos importantes. Reconocer estos desafíos desde un principio puede ayudar a mitigar riesgos.

  • Falta de apoyo ejecutivo:Sin el respaldo de nivel superior, los arquitectos tienen dificultades para imponer estándares o influir en las decisiones.
  • Sobrediseño:Crear modelos excesivamente complejos que son difíciles de mantener o entender.
  • Resistencia al cambio:Las unidades de negocio podrían resistir nuevas normas si las perciben como obstáculos burocráticos.
  • Información desactualizada:Si el repositorio de arquitectura no se mantiene, se vuelve obsoleto rápidamente.
  • Desconexión de la realidad:Los arquitectos que no entienden las limitaciones técnicas o las realidades empresariales podrían diseñar soluciones no implementables.

El futuro de la Arquitectura Empresarial 🔮

A medida que la tecnología evoluciona, también lo hace la disciplina de la Arquitectura Empresarial. Varias tendencias están moldeando el futuro de la EA.

Arquitecturas nativas en la nube

Las organizaciones están dejando atrás las estructuras monolíticas para adoptar arquitecturas nativas en la nube basadas en microservicios. Esto requiere un cambio de enfoque desde la infraestructura hacia la orquestación de servicios y la gestión de API.

Enfoque centrado en los datos

Con el auge de la inteligencia artificial y el aprendizaje automático, la arquitectura de datos está volviéndose tan crítica como la arquitectura empresarial. La capacidad para gestionar la gobernanza de datos, su trazabilidad y su calidad se está convirtiendo en una responsabilidad principal de la EA.

Agilidad e integración con DevOps

La EA tradicional solía considerarse lenta y burocrática. La EA moderna se está integrando con prácticas Ágiles y DevOps, permitiendo una validación continua de la arquitectura en lugar de revisiones periódicas.

Automatización

Las herramientas están automatizando cada vez más el descubrimiento de sistemas existentes y la generación de modelos de arquitectura. Esto reduce la carga manual sobre los arquitectos y mantiene la arquitectura actualizada.

Preguntas frecuentes ❓

¿La Arquitectura Empresarial solo es para empresas grandes?

No. Aunque las grandes empresas tienen sistemas más complejos, las pequeñas y medianas también se benefician de la EA. Les ayuda a evitar errores costosos, planificar el crecimiento y gestionar eficazmente la deuda técnica.

¿En qué se diferencia la EA de la Estrategia de TI?

La Estrategia de TI se enfoca en los objetivos y la dirección de alto nivel de la función de TI. La EA proporciona el plano detallado y los estándares para alcanzar esos objetivos. La Estrategia de TI es el «qué» y el «por qué»; la EA es el «cómo» y el «dónde».

¿Cuánto tiempo tarda en implementarse la EA?

No existe una cronología fija. Depende del tamaño de la organización y del alcance de la primera fase de implementación. Sin embargo, un enfoque por fases permite obtener resultados valor en meses en lugar de años.

¿Necesito comprar software específico para la EA?

No. Aunque existen herramientas disponibles para gestionar repositorios y modelos de arquitectura, el núcleo de la EA es el pensamiento y el proceso. Muchas organizaciones comienzan con hojas de cálculo y herramientas de modelado estándar antes de invertir en software especializado.

¿Cuál es el papel de un Arquitecto Empresarial?

Un Arquitecto Empresarial actúa como traductor entre los negocios y la tecnología. Aseguran que las inversiones tecnológicas generen valor para los negocios, gestionan el riesgo técnico y impulsan la innovación. Deben poseer tanto conocimientos técnicos como habilidades empresariales.

Conclusión 💡

La Arquitectura Empresarial es una disciplina fundamental para las organizaciones que buscan prosperar en un entorno digital complejo. Proporciona la estructura necesaria para alinear las inversiones tecnológicas con los objetivos empresariales, asegurando que cada dólar gastado contribuya a los objetivos estratégicos.

Al comprender los dominios principales, aprovechar marcos establecidos y enfrentar los desafíos de la implementación, las organizaciones pueden construir una base resistente y ágil. El camino es continuo, requiriendo adaptación constante y colaboración. Con una visión clara y un enfoque disciplinado, la Arquitectura Empresarial se transforma de un concepto teórico en un motor tangible del éxito.